第3章可编程控制器概述_第1页
第3章可编程控制器概述_第2页
第3章可编程控制器概述_第3页
第3章可编程控制器概述_第4页
第3章可编程控制器概述_第5页
已阅读5页,还剩34页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

第3章可编程控制器概述第一页,共39页。可编程控制器原理及应用西门子S7-200系列第二页,共39页。第3章可编程控制器概述主要内容

PLC的产生和定义PLC的发展与分类PLC的特点PLC的应用PLC的系统组成PLC的工作原理PLC的编程语言和程序结构EXIT第三页,共39页。本章学习要求掌握内容:

PLC的定义、功能、分类及特点了解内容:

PLC产生、发展难点内容:

PLC的分类EXIT第四页,共39页。3.1PLC的产生和定义

*

20世纪20年代以来,继电器控制曾一度占据工业控制领域的主导地位。*继电器控制系统的弱点:体积大、耗电多、可靠性差、寿命短、运行速度慢、适应性差,等。尤其是可靠性差、不具有通用性、灵活性。3.1.1PLC的产生EXIT第五页,共39页。因为继电器逻辑电路配线复杂EXIT第六页,共39页。*1968年美国最大的汽车制造商通用汽车公司(GM),拟定了十项公开招标的技术要求*

1969年美国数字设备公司(DEC)研制出世界上第一台可编程控制器(PDP-14型)第七页,共39页。十项技术要求

1.编程简单方便,可在现场修改程序;2.硬件维护方便,最好是插件式结构;3.可靠性要高于继电器控制装置;4.体积小于继电器控制装置;5.可将数据直接送入管理计算机;6.成本上可与继电器柜竞争;7.输入可以是交流115V;8.输出为交流115V,2A以上,能直接驱动电磁阀;9.扩展时,原有系统只需做很小的改动;10.用户程序存储器容量至少可以扩展到4KB。EXIT第八页,共39页。核心思想

用计算机代替继电器控制盘用程序代替硬接线输入/输出电平可与外部设备直接相连结构易扩展EXIT第九页,共39页。3.1.2PLC的定义可编程控制器(ProgrammableController)是以微处理器为基础,综合了计算机技术、自动控制技术和通信技术等现代科技而发展起来的一种新型工业自动控制装置,是将计算机技术应用于工业控制领域的新产品。早期的可编程控制器主要用来代替继电器实现逻辑控制,因此称为可编程逻辑控制器(ProgrammableLogicController),简称PLC。随着技术发展,现代可编程控制器的功能已经超过了逻辑控制的范围。PLC实质上是一种工业控制计算机

EXIT第十页,共39页。3.2PLC的发展与分类3.2.1PLC的发展趋势简易化、体积小、功能强、价格低。大存储容量、高速度、高性能、增加I/O点数。

增强网络通信功能发展智能模块外部故障诊断功能编程语言、编程工具标准化、高级化实现软件、硬件标准化编程组态软件发展迅速小型化大型化智能化EXIT第十一页,共39页。传送带生产线控制灌装及包装机械木材加工电梯控制空调控制纺织机械印刷机械第十二页,共39页。3.2.2PLC的分类1.按I/O点数容量分EXIT第十三页,共39页。2.按结构形式分EXIT第十四页,共39页。整体式第十五页,共39页。模块式PowerinaSmallPackage!!电源模块CPU模块IO模块底板EXIT第十六页,共39页。PLC著名品牌美国A-B公司(Allen-Bradley)德国西门子公司(Siemens)美国GE-Fanuc公司美国的莫迪康(Modicon)和法国的TE电器公司日本欧姆公司(OMRON)日本三菱电机株式会社(MITSUBISHI)日本富士电机株式会社(FujiElectric)日本东芝公司(TOSHIBA)日本的光洋电子(KOYO)和中国的华光电子(CKE)日本松下电工株式会社(MEW):MatsushitaElectricWorksLtdEXIT第十七页,共39页。3.3PLC的特点可靠性高、抗干扰能力强通用性强、灵活性好编程简单、使用方便模块化结构安装简便、调试方便3.4PLC的应用顺序控制运动控制过程控制数据处理通信网络EXIT第十八页,共39页。3.5PLC的系统组成EXIT第十九页,共39页。3.5.1中央处理器(CPU)微处理器控制接口电路CPU★微处理器:实现逻辑运算、数学运算,协调控制系统内部各部分的工作★按照系统程序所赋予的任务运行★任务:1.控制接收与存储用户程序和数据2.进行自诊断3.

执行用户程序EXIT第二十页,共39页。控制接口电路

是微处理器与主机内部其他单元进行联系的部件数据缓冲单元选择信号匹配中断管理功能EXIT第二十一页,共39页。3.5.2存储器系统程序存储器

用户程序存储器

存储器1.系统程序存储器存放:监控程序用户指令解释标准程序模块系统调用管理程序系统参数系统程序关系到PLC的性能,不能由用户访问和修改。

EXIT第二十二页,共39页。2.用户程序存储器用户程序区数据区系统区用户程序存储器用户程序工作数据系统参数系统参数(CPU组态数据):*输入输出组态

*功能的设置

EXIT第二十三页,共39页。3.5.3输入/输出接口PLC的CPU与现场I/O装置或其他外部设备之间连接的接口部件电平转换功率放大光电耦合

电平转换光电耦合

EXIT第二十四页,共39页。1.直流输入2.交流输入EXIT第二十五页,共39页。3.直流输出4.交流输出EXIT第二十六页,共39页。5.交直流输出(继电器输出)EXIT第二十七页,共39页。把外部电源变换成系统内部各单元电源的性能直接影响PLC的抗干扰能力掉电保护电路后备电池电源3.5.4电源部分EXIT第二十八页,共39页。程序的编制、编辑、调试、监视······简易型智能型计算机编程通信接口编程软件3.5.5编程器EXIT第二十九页,共39页。3.6PLC的工作原理3.6.1PLC的工作方式和运行框图结构、功能相同1.PLC控制系统与继电器控制系统的比较EXIT第三十页,共39页。2.循环扫描的工作方式周期循环扫描一个循环扫描过程所需的时间称为一个扫描周期

EXIT第三十一页,共39页。3.6.2PLC的扫描工作过程EXIT第三十二页,共39页。3.7PLC的编程语言和程序结构3.7.1PLC的编程语言梯形图语句表功能图功能块图能流“软继电器”不是物理继电器触点不是现场物理开关的触点输出线圈不是物理线圈接点原则上可无限次使用,线圈通常只引用一次1.梯形图(LAD)常开触点是取位状态操作常闭触点是位取反操作常闭触点常开触点EXIT第三十三页,共39页。2.语句表(STL)

EXIT第三十四页,共39页。3.顺序功能流程图(SFC)

4.功能块图(FBD)

顺序功能流程图(SepuenceFunctionChart)编程是一种图形化的编程方法,亦称功能图。使用它可以对具有并发、选择等复杂结构的系统进行编程。本书的第4章对这种编程方法有详细介绍。没有梯形图编程器中的触点和线圈,但有与之等价的指令,这些指令是作为盒指令出现的,程序逻辑由这些盒指令之间的连接决定。FBD编程语言有利于程序流的跟踪,但在目前使用较少。

EXIT第三十五页,共39页。3.7.2PLC的程序结构1.用户程序(1)主程序(2)子程序(3)中断处理程序2.数据块3.参数块EXIT第三十六页,共39页。如果编

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论